Stop googling SAP errors. Use our Free Essentials plan instead - no credit card needed. Start Now

Close

How To Fix WSTRN078 - No application log is available


SAP Error Message - Details

  • Message type: E = Error

  • Message class: WSTRN - Message for Prepack Creation and Planning Dialog

  • Message number: 078

  • Message text: No application log is available

  • Show details Hide details


  • Self-Explanatory Message

    Since SAP believes that this specific error message is 'self-explanatory,' no more information has been given.The majority of messages in the SAP system have a message text, however this is frequently insufficient to comprehend or resolve the problem.

    To make things easier, more detailed information is frequently added to describe the issue, how to fix it, and the necessary steps or configuration modifications.

    Unfortunately, there isn't any extra information in this error notice.



    What else can you do?

    First, use our AnswerBot below to get a possible cause and solution (requires a premium subscription).

    Also, review the in-depth Common Questions & Answers listed below; you could discover a solution there or be able to connect with others who have faced similar challenges.

    You can also try searching the SAP support portal (support.sap.com) but you need a special user ID to access it. It is possible that an SAP support note exists that provides additional details about the mistake or even steps for fixing it.


Smart SAP Assistant

  • What is the cause and solution for SAP error message WSTRN078 - No application log is available ?

    SAP Error Message:
    WSTRN078 No application log is available


    Cause:

    This message typically appears when an SAP transaction or program attempts to display an application log, but no log entries exist for the specified object or process. In other words, the system is trying to access an application log that has not been created or is empty.

    Common scenarios include:

    • The process or transaction did not generate any log entries.
    • The log entries were deleted or archived.
    • The log object or sub-object specified does not match any existing logs.
    • The log retrieval parameters (such as object, sub-object, external ID, or date range) are incorrect or too restrictive.

    Explanation:

    SAP application logs are used to record messages, errors, and status information during processing. They are managed via transaction SLG1 (Application Log: Display Logs). When a program calls the function module or method to read logs, if no entries are found, the system issues the WSTRN078 message.


    Solution:

    1. Check if the process generated logs:

      • Verify that the process or transaction you are running is supposed to generate application logs.
      • If it is a custom program, ensure that the logging functionality is implemented correctly.
    2. Use transaction SLG1 to verify logs:

      • Go to transaction SLG1.
      • Enter the Object and Subobject related to your process.
      • Adjust the date range and other selection criteria.
      • Execute to see if any logs exist.
      • If no logs appear, it confirms that no logs were created.
    3. Review the parameters used to fetch logs:

      • Check the parameters passed to the log retrieval function/module.
      • Ensure the object, sub-object, external ID, and date range are correct and correspond to existing logs.
    4. If logs are expected but missing:

      • Investigate why the process did not create logs.
      • Check the program or transaction code for proper logging calls (e.g., calls to BAL_LOG_CREATE, BAL_LOG_MSG_ADD, BAL_DB_SAVE).
      • Check for authorization issues that might prevent log creation.
    5. If logs were deleted or archived:

      • Logs can be deleted or archived using transaction SLG2 or background jobs.
      • Confirm if logs were removed and if they need to be restored or re-created.

    Related Information:

    • Transaction SLG1: Display Application Log
    • Transaction SLG2: Delete Application Log
    • Function Modules:
      • BAL_LOG_CREATE – Create application log
      • BAL_LOG_MSG_ADD – Add message to application log
      • BAL_DB_SAVE – Save application log to database
    • SAP Note: Check for any SAP Notes related to your specific module or process that might address logging issues.

    Summary:

    • WSTRN078 means no application log entries were found.
    • Verify if logs should exist and check with SLG1.
    • Confirm correct parameters and logging implementation.
    • Investigate if logs were deleted or never created.

    If you provide the context or transaction where this error occurs, I can help with more specific guidance.

    • Do you have any question about this error?


      Upgrade now to chat with this error.


Instant HelpGet instant SAP help. Sign up for our Free Essentials Plan.


Related SAP Error Messages

Click the links below to see the following related messages:

Click on this link to search all SAP messages.


Rating
ERPlingo simplifies finding the accurate answers to SAP message errors. I now use every week. A must have tool for anyone working with SAP! Highly recommended!
Rate 1
Kent Bettisworth
Executive SAP Consultant